Man-in-the-middle attack means that the middleman completes the data exchange between the server and the client. In the server’s view, all the messages are from or sent to the client; in the client’s view, all the messages are also from or sent to the server side. If a hacker uses a man-in-the-middle attack, the hacker will send at least two packets as shown to implement the attack.
